Dosage & Administration

Directions Do not take more than directed (see overdose warning) Adults and children 12 years and over: • Take 2 tablets every 6 hours while symptoms last • Swallow whole – do not crush, chew or dissolve • Do not take more than 6 tablets in 24 hours, unless directed by a doctor • Do not use for more than 10 days unless directed by a doctor Children under 12 years • Ask a doctor

Warnings & Precautions
Warnings Liver warning: This product contains acetaminophen. Severe liver damage may occur if you take: • More than 6tablets in 24 hours, which is the maximum daily amount • With other drugs containing acetaminophen • 3 or more alcoholic drinks every day while using this product Allergy alert: Acetaminophen may cayse severe skin reactions. Symptoms may include • Skin reddening • Blisters • Rash If skin reaction occurs, stop use and seek medical help right away

When Using

Do not use • With any other drug containing acetaminophen (prescription or nonprescription). If you are not sure whether a drug contains acetaminophen, ask a doctor or pharmacist. • For more than 10 days for pain unless directed by a doctor • For more than 3 days for fever unless directed by a doctor

Stop Use & Ask a Doctor

Stop using and ask a doctor if • Symptoms do not improve • New symptoms occur • Pain or fever persists or gets worse
